Inspection History
May 2, 2025
Routine - Food
3 minor violations.
View 3 violations
Basic - Mobile food dispensing vehicle license number not permanently affixed on the side of the unit in figures at least 2 inches high and in contrasting colors from the background of the vehicle. Observed license number not on unit.
50-04-4
Basic - No Heimlich maneuver/choking sign posted. Observed no choking poster on uni. E-mailed copy of choking poster to operator.
51-13-4
Basic - No conspicuously located ambient air temperature thermometer in holding unit. Observed no ambient thermometer in single door holding unit.
05-09-4
